Lost Vegas by Tim Levy
A photographic exhibition held at Black Eye Gallery. This exhibition is a culmination of 3 visits over 5 years. As a street photographer, you can only attempt to record what you find interesting, unusual, extraordinary, funny, ironic, empathy inducing or signs of the time. But mostly, Vegas is a microcosm of the U.S. – full of glitz, glamour, ‘freedom’, entertainment and brilliant inventions and its flip side – false hope, cheap highs and increasingly insane amounts of wealth inequality.
Exhibition Dates: 30/1/18 – 11/02/18, 10am-6pm.
Opening Night: Thursday 1st Feb, 6-8pm.
